Spatial eigenfunctions qα, mode(r, θ, m) for the ζz-symmetric columnar convective modes with m = 2. By definition, modes are of the form qα, mode(r, θ, m)exp[i(mϕωt)], where qα is either vr, vθ, vϕ, or p1. (a) Meridional cuts of the radial velocity vr, latitudinal velocity vθ, longitudinal velocity vϕ, and pressure perturbation p1 extracted from the convection simulation (lower panels) and obtained from our linear calculation (upper panels). (b) Radial dependence of the eigenfunction vϕ at the equator. The black solid and red dashed lines represent the simulation and linear calculation, respectively. (c) Latitudinal eigenfunction of vϕ at the surface normalized near the equator.
